Oracle Lighting Launching RAM Rebel/TRX Front Bumper Flush LED Light Bar System During 2021 SEMA Expo

METAIRIE, LA (10.27.2021) – Oracle Lighting has announced the launch of the Rebel/TRX Front Bumper Flush LED Light Bar System for 2019-2022 RAM 1500 Rebel and 2021-2022 RAM 1500 TRX (p/n 5885-001/006) during the 2021 SEMA Show, held in Las Vegas, Nev. from Nov. 2-5 at the Las Vegas Convention Center, booth #C20547. Now available for pre-order and scheduled to ship in November, the new LED Light Bar System has an MSRP of $449.95.

“This unique new lighting system provides functional forward LED lighting while maintaining a factory appearance,” explained Justin Hartenstein, Oracle Lighting director of development. “Our high powered 100W LED light bar is fitted into a housing which is designed to mimic the shape of the original factory bumper and integrate into the front end of the 2019+ RAM 1500 TRX or Rebel.”

The lighting system is installed using rivet nuts, which require two holes 3/8in. to attach the bar to the bumper. Wiring can easily connect to the factory AUX switches. If your truck is not equipped with AUX switches, Oracle Lighting recommends you add Oracle’s switched light bar wiring harness (p/n #2088-504).

Additional product specifications and features include:

  • Housing: Polycarbonate
  • Lens: Optically Clear Lexan
  • Watts: 100W (20x 5W LED)
  • Amperage: 7.5A @ 12VDC
  • LED: Osram CRDP LED Chip
  • Lumen Output: 12,000lm
  • LED Life: 50,000+ Hours
  • Optics: Mixed Spot/ Flood
  • Color Temperature: 5500K
  • Ingress Protection: IP69K
  • Input Voltage: 9V-36V DC


Package includes:

  • Front Bumper Flush LED Light Bar System
  • Mounting Hardware

Retro Manufacturing Introduces the Denver Radio

HENDERSON, NV (10.27.2021) – Retro Manufacturing has created a new radio for classic 60s vehicles like the International Scout that had smaller dash openings than the RetroRadio can accommodate. The Denver was designed to be similar to the RetroRadio but have a smaller nose at just 3.5” wide by 1.5” tall adding hundreds of 60s classic vehicle fitments to the robust RetroSound line-up. Classic car enthusiasts with 60s-70s GM, Chevrolet, International, and import vehicles can now seamlessly add modern sound to their classics without cutting or altering the original dash. The Denver is available in black or chrome with sleek rounded edges and classic push-buttons for a truly authentic look and feel.

The Denver is compatible with all RetroSound Radio Motors giving classic car fans all the features of a modern car stereo. Available features include built-in Bluetooth for hands-free calls and audio streaming, Made for iPod/iPhone compatibility, USB inputs for flash drives and media devices, and non-volatile memory. A 32,000 color digital display gives users the option to customize the display color to match their gauges and browse through media by artist, song title, or album.

The Denver has a selectable AM/FM Tuner allowing the user to select between USA, EUR, AUS, JAP, and RUS turner frequencies with 30 pre-sets to store favorite stations. A powerful 300-watt built-in amplifier provides plenty of power over 4 channels along with RCA pre-outs and a subwoofer output for customers looking to expand their audio system further. The Denver is available with SiriusXM, connecting directly to an SXV300V1 Connect Vehicle Tuner (sold separately) without the need for special adapters or cables. The SXV300V1 tuner adds SiriusXM broadcasts to your RetroSound radio with artist, channel, and song information shown directly on the radios display. The Denver is also available with HD Radio technology and DAB+ for superior radio reception.

MSRP on the Denver starts at $199.99 and will be available early 2022 at www.retromanufacturing.com.

2021 SEMA Show to Feature OEM and Custom Vehicle Debuts, Thousands of New Products, Interactive Experiences, and Celebrity Experiences

DIAMOND BAR, CA (10.26.2021) – The annual Specialty Equipment Market Association (SEMA) Show kicks off on Nov. 2, 2021, at the Las Vegas Convention Center in Las Vegas, Nev., and runs through Nov. 5. More than 1,300 exhibiting companies are signed up to participate and, to-date, nearly 50,000 buyers have registered to attend.

The SEMA Show is the annual trade show for the automotive aftermarket industry and is one of the largest gatherings of small businesses in the United States. This year’s show has expanded its footprint to include exhibit space in all four Las Vegas Convention Center halls, including the newly constructed West Hall – a 1.4-million square-foot facility that will be used to enhance the attendee experience. The Show features thousands of new products along with never-before-seen vehicle debuts from major OEMs, custom vehicle unveilings from leading customizers and coach builders and a host of celebrity appearances throughout the week.

“Businesses are eager to reconnect at the SEMA Show,” said Tom Gattuso, SEMA VP of events. “Participants at this year’s SEMA Show will be able to see thousands of new products in a way they haven’t been able to do in nearly two years. With product demonstrations, interactive exhibits, and in-person meetings, the SEMA Show will provide manufacturers and resellers an opportunity to accelerate their business.”

Other highlights of this year’s show include the largest collection of Chip Foose-built vehicles featured in a special corral that highlights some of the most influential and important vehicles created at Foose Design; a display of over 50 off-road racing vehicles ranging from motorcycles to trophy trucks in SCORE’s Baja 1000 Experience; and interactive driving demos, including the return of the Hoonigan Burnyard Bash in the Silver Lot and the “Ford Out Front” experience, which features drift and off-road vehicle demos.

JL Audio Now Standard on All 2022 Harris Luxury Pontoon Boats, Including the All-New Grand Mariner

MIRAMAR, FL (10.25.2021) – JL Audio, manufacturer of high-end marine audio solutions, announces today that its audio solutions will now come standard on all 2022 model year Harris pontoonboats and luxury pontoon boats, including the redesigned Grand Mariner. The Grand Mariner will be offered with three audio packages, standard, diamond and platinum, each composed entirely of JL Audio products.

Working closely with Harris early in the design phase, JL Audio assesses the workable area of a boat to optimally place audio components for peak performance. In the case of the 2022 model year Grand Mariner, JL Audio in collaboration with Harris created an elevated sound stage that is ideally suited for how Pontoons are used. To do this, the full-range speakers were raised and integrated into the seat back within the entertainment area, instead to being near the floor, as was the case on previous model years. This seemingly subtle change resulted in sound immersing all passengers in the boat, providing them a n ideal music experience.

“Like automobiles, when audio systems are designed into a boat and engineered by audio experts they can produce a breathtaking listening experience,” said Ora Freeman, Director OEM Sales, North America, JL Audio. “Working with Harris’s design team early in the development of the new Grand Mariner, we applied our team’s robust understanding of open-air acoustics to engineer an audio system that takes music enjoyment on the water to new heights.”

All 2022 luxury pontoon boat models from Harris, including Solstice, Crown, and Grand Mariner, will come standard with a high-performance JL Audio system – further extending the relationship with JL Audio. Harris will also offer two optional audio upgrade packages:

  • Standard – JL Audio MediaMaster 50 marine source unit and six JL Audio M3 marine coaxial speakers
  • Diamond Package – Builds on the Standard audio package, replacing the MediaMaster 50 with an HD Audio-equipped MediaMaster 105 and adds a 10-inch JL Audio M3 subwoofer and JL Audio M- series amplifiers to drive the system
  • Platinum – Evolves a combination of Standard and Diamond audio packages, upgrading the components to JL Audio MVi reference-grade marine amplifiers with integrated DSP and M6 marine coaxial speakers with Transflective RGB lighting along with two subwoofers in custom enclosures
